From my experience students learn better, when you connect the theoretical part with the reality.
Your learning experience will be better, if you have real parts (actors) which are controlled by your program.
You can get many stuff here: https://www.adafruit.com/
Micro controller with Micropython support:
- https://micropython.org/
- https://pycom.io/
- http://tpyboard.com/
- (if you want to save money) https://www.google.de/search?q=esp8266&tbm=shop
Just search with google for cool raspberry pi projects to get inspiration for your own future projects.
